Output 24ccd4106ba58c90381282dfa3e471223878879ce555b9dfa44bc73978239b36:1

value
2370578
script pubkey
OP_0 OP_PUSHBYTES_20 507cd7926c039607e518634705387952b8973271
address
bc1q2p7d0ynvqwtq0egcvdrs2wre22ufwvn3l5p2yc
transaction
24ccd4106ba58c90381282dfa3e471223878879ce555b9dfa44bc73978239b36
spent
true